Five years relevant work experience is suggested. </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<br /> </div> <h1 style="margin:0px 0px 10px;padding:0px;text-size-adjust:none;font-size:20px;color:#FF9900;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> Update Announcement on HCIE-Routing &amp; Switching to HCIE-Datacom </h1>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> 1. On June 30, 2022, the system will automatically extend the written exam scores validation (from April 1, 2022 to June 30, 2023) of HCIE-Routing &amp; Switching to June 30, 2023, and convert them into HCIE -Datacom written exam scores. Candidates can use the scores to make an appointment to take the HCIE-Datacom lab exam. </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> 2. On June 30, 2022, the system will automatically convert the scores of the HCIE-Routing &amp; Switching written exam (score generated from January 1, 2022 to June 30, 2022) into the HCIE-Datacom written exam scores. The written exam scores are still valid for 18 months from the date of passing the exam. Candidates can use the scores to make an appointment to take the HCIE-Datacom lab exam. </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> 3. On June 30, 2022, the system will automatically update the un-used HCIE-Routing &amp; Switching lab vouchers validation (from April 1, 2022 until June 30, 2023) to June 30, 2023. Support un-used HCIE-Routing &amp; Switching lab vouchers to book HCIE-Datacom lab exams. </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<br /> </div> <h1 style="margin:0px 0px 10px;padding:0px;text-size-adjust:none;font-size:20px;color:#FF9900;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> HCIE-Datacom V1.0 Exam Overview </h1>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<img src="https://www.passcert.com/T/PC-COM/images/uploads/20220430035031_9712.png" width="607" height="250" alt="" border="0" style="margin:0px;padding:0px;text-size-adjust:none;" /><br /> </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<br /> </div> <h1 style="margin:0px 0px 10px;padding:0px;text-size-adjust:none;font-size:20px;color:#FF9900;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> Exam Content </h1>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> The HCIE-Datacom V1.0 Certification Exam covers routing and switching advanced technologies,panoramic view of enterprise network architecture, typical architecture and technologies of campus network, planning and deployment of Huawei CloudCampus solution, typical architecture and technologies of WAN interconnection, planning and deployment of Huawei SD-WAN solution, typical architecture and technologies of bearer WAN, planning and deployment of Huawei CloudWAN solution, network automation technologies and practice. </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<br /> </div> <h1 style="margin:0px 0px 10px;padding:0px;text-size-adjust:none;font-size:20px;color:#FF9900;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> Knowledge points </h1>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<img src="https://www.passcert.com/T/PC-COM/images/uploads/20220430035103_6817.png" alt="" border="0" style="margin:0px;padding:0px;text-size-adjust:none;" /><br /> </div>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> <br /> </div> <h1 style="margin:0px 0px 10px;padding:0px;text-size-adjust:none;font-size:20px;color:#FF9900;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> Share HCIE-Datacom V1.0 H12-891_V1.0-ENU Sample Questions </h1> <div style="margin:0px;padding:0px;text-size-adjust:none;color:#333333;font-family:Verdana, Arial, Helvetica, sans-serif;white-space:normal;"> Which of the following statement about ISIS (IPv6) is correct?
